Perseverance That Silences Opposition

Nehemiah 6:16 (KJV) 

And it came to pass, that when all our enemies heard thereof, and all the heathen that were about us saw these things, they were much cast down in their own eyes: for they perceived that this work was wrought of our God. 

Our anchored Scripture illuminates a powerful truth: the enemies of Israel felt disheartened and humiliated upon witnessing the completed wall, recognizing it as a testament to God’s hand at work. This moment marks a significant triumph, as Nehemiah and the Israelites rebuilt Jerusalem’s wall in just 52 days despite immense opposition. Their adversaries, including Sanballat and Tobiah, were forced to confront their failed attempts to intimidate or sabotage the project, realizing that divine assistance had empowered the Israelites. Nehemiah embraced this monumental task, navigating not only logistical hurdles but also the relentless resistance of those who wished to thwart God’s mission. Through unwavering prayer, perseverance, and a clear vision, he rose above fear and discouragement. Despite repeated attempts to lure him away or threaten him, Nehemiah remained steadfast, discerning, and focused on the work God had entrusted to him. His resolve to complete the task stemmed from a profound understanding that his efforts played a vital role in God’s grand design for His people. The enemies, once brimming with confidence in their schemes to hinder Nehemiah, were confronted with the undeniable progress achieved. They recognized this endeavor as far beyond mere human capability. Their realization that God drove this monumental work led them to despair; they understood that when God is on our side, no weapon formed against us can prevail.
